**Mgmt Meeting Minutes — Retiring the Brightline Range**

Quick recap for sales leads at Fenholt Supplies: we agreed to retire the Brightline fixture range by year-end. Remaining stock moves to clearance pricing next month, and accounts on standing orders get migrated to the Lumetta range. Trade-in incentives were approved in principle. The confidential note on next steps sits just below.

board note of bajof-bajeg: The pricing group signed off on a budget of $13.4 million for Project Sildor. The renewal with Lamixek Holdings closes at $48.9 million a year, 49 percent above the last contract.

Formula sandbox review checklist for Gridsum. User-supplied formulas run in the Cellbox interpreter with no filesystem or network access. Verify the evaluation timeout (250ms default) is enforced and recursion depth capped at 32. Any change touching the sandbox boundary needs two approvals. To replay quarantined formulas against the Cellbox staging API, use the key below.

gateway credential: kto23_LX9A4ys6i4nzHtpOLNLodKK

Handover note — to the receiving site at Dunmere Hall. Enclosed are the original score sheets from the Westvale Regional Chess Final, all 64 boards, sorted by round and initialled by arbiter Corin Vasse. Please keep them in order; the federation audit requires the originals untouched, so make working copies only after sign-in. The satchel is sealed with a numbered tag. At the courier hand-over, follow the confidential instruction directly below.

drop instructions, fajop-fajep: the druix oliox courier leaves the kelix ulaox normir ulador briath kasax gorys oliir ledger at gate 3848 under passcode 120698